Ardent is seeking a GIS Systems Architect to join our team. This is a remote position.
We are looking for a GIS
Systems Architect who will play a critical role in designing, developing, and maintaining advanced geospatial system architectures to support federal government programs. This position provides technical leadership and expertise in systems engineering, integration, and cloud‑based geospatial solutions. The architect collaborates closely with stakeholders to assess business needs, recommend emerging technologies, and ensure scalable, secure, and compliant geospatial systems. This role requires a strong understanding of GIS technologies, federal compliance standards, and enterprise IT environments to effectively support and advance geospatial data infrastructure and applications.

- Design, develop, and maintain scalable, resilient, and interoperable geospatial system architectures aligned with DHS standards.
- Conduct gap analysis and identify technical and functional requirements to meet geospatial business objectives.
- Research, evaluate, and recommend emerging geospatial technologies and enterprise solutions.
- Lead systems integration and architecture design across cloud (including hybrid) and on‑premises environments.
- Manage geospatial data infrastructure including geodatabases, metadata, data warehouses, and cloud‑based repositories.
- Support operation, maintenance, troubleshooting, and performance optimization of GIS applications and databases.
- Develop, maintain, and execute testing plans to validate system performance and operational effectiveness.
- Create and update architectural documentation, SOPs, technical guides, and other related artifacts.
- Ensure compliance with federal IT policies, DHS directives, security standards, and accessibility requirements.
- Collaborate with cross‑functional teams and stakeholders to align technical architecture with organizational goals.
- Provide technical leadership and mentorship to junior engineers and staff.
- Bachelor’s degree in Computer Science, Information Technology, Geospatial Science, or a related field (or equivalent experience).
- Proven experience as a Systems Architect or similar role supporting geospatial systems in government or large enterprise environments.
- Strong expertise in systems engineering, architecture design, and GIS technologies, particularly Esri products.
- Experience with cloud environments (AWS, Azure, or Gov Cloud), hybrid cloud architectures, and data storage solutions.
- Proficient in database design, management, and configuration, including geodatabases and spatial data repositories.
- Knowledge of federal IT security frameworks and compliance standards (e.g., FISMA, Section 508, DHS management directives).
- Familiarity with software development lifecycle (SDLC), Dev Sec Ops , and CI/CD practices for GIS applications.
- Excellent problem‑solving, analytical, and communication skills.
- Ability to work effectively with diverse teams and manage multiple priorities.
